The Racers (1955)
THE THRILLS ROAR DOWN ON YOU!
An Italian daredevil turns Grand Prix driver and works his way up to Le Mans with his ballerina lover.
Director: Henry Hathaway
Genre: Drama
Runtime: 88 min
Release Date: February 4, 1955
Cast
- Kirk Douglas - Gino Borgesa
- Bella Darvi - Nicole
- Gilbert Roland - Dell'Oro
- Cesar Romero - Carlos Chavez
- Lee J. Cobb - Maglio
- Katy Jurado - Maria Chávez
- Charles Goldner - Piero
- John Hudson - Michel Caron
- George Dolenz - Count Salem
- Agnès Laury - Toni
Screenplay
- Hans Ruesch (Novel)
- Charles Kaufman (Screenplay)
Music: Alex North
Cinematography: Joseph MacDonald
Editing: James B. Clark
Production: 20th Century Fox
Country: United States of America
Language: English
